Visual Studio Code C++开发环境配置详图与实战指南
版权申诉

本篇教程详细介绍了如何在Visual Studio Code(VScode)中配置C/C++开发环境,对于初次接触或者需要优化C/C++开发流程的开发者来说是一份宝贵的指南。以下是关键步骤:
1. **初始配置**:
- 首先,访问Visual Studio Code官网下载最新版本的VScode:[官方链接](https://code.visualstudio.com),确保安装适用于您的操作系统。
- 接着,前往mingw64官网获取跨平台的MinGW编译器:[mingw-w64官网](http://mingw-w64.org/doku.php)。根据您的操作系统选择合适的版本,并将下载的bin目录添加到系统环境变量中,以便后续调用。
2. **安装扩展**:
- 如果对英文界面不适应,推荐安装中文包扩展,以提高开发体验。安装C/C++相关的扩展有助于代码高亮、智能提示等功能。
3. **调试运行环境**:
- 创建一个新的C++源文件。为了设置调试功能,需创建`launch.json`文件。可以通过VScode内置功能选择“自定义运行和调试”创建该文件,并指定编译器为GDB或LLDB。
- 在`launch.json`中配置`g++.exe`,用于生成和调试活动文件。通过点击编译按钮或快捷键来执行这些设置。
- 同样,创建`tasks.json`文件,配置C/C++:g++.exe任务,以便在按Ctrl+Shift+P快捷键后,选择此任务并运行代码。
4. **快捷键操作**:
- 快捷键组合ALT+SHIFT+F可以一键整理代码,提升编码效率。
- F5键用于启动调试,执行代码并在设置好的断点处暂停。
- CTRL+ALT+N键则是运行代码而不会进入调试模式。
5. **总结**:
- 这篇文章提供了Visual Studio Code配置C/C++开发环境的完整流程,包括基础设置和常用操作。对于想要在VScode上高效开发C++项目的开发者来说,这个教程提供了一条清晰的路径。阅读完这篇文章后,读者应该能够顺利开始他们的C++开发工作,并且可以根据需求进一步探索其他相关主题。
希望通过这个教程,您能更轻松地掌握VScode在C/C++开发中的应用,如有任何疑问,可以参考作者提供的额外资源或关注他们后续的文章。
3944 浏览量
5539 浏览量
点击了解资源详情
21667 浏览量
2417 浏览量
1604 浏览量
683 浏览量

weixin_38502916
- 粉丝: 2
最新资源
- 深入解析ELF文件格式及其在操作系统中的应用
- C++ Primer 第四版习题解答(前五章)
- 数学建模必备:实用先进算法详解
- 500毫秒打字游戏实现与键盘事件处理
- 轨迹跟踪算法:无根求曲线绘制的高效方法
- UML指南:Java程序员的全面设计实践
- 探索WPF:新一代Web呈现技术
- 轻量级Java企业应用:POJO实战
- Linux指令详解:cat、cd和chmod
- 使用SWIG将C++绑定到Python的实战指南
- 掌握Linux shell编程:实战指南与变量操作
- Linux多用户创建与设备挂载指南
- Tapestry4入门与框架演变解析
- C#入门指南:从语言概述到实战编程
- MIME类型详解:从电子邮件到浏览器的多媒体数据处理
- Solaris10操作系统学习指南